Sufra

A sufra, sofra, or sofreh (Arabic: سُفْرَة; Persian: سفره; Turkish: sofra; Georgian: სუფრა; Armenian: սուփրա) is a cloth or table for the serving of food, or, in an extended sense, a kind of meal, associated with Islamicate culture. == Forms of the sufra == The word comes from the Semitic root s-f-r, associated with sweeping motions and with journeys (also giving rise to the word borrowed into English as safari).
